Jakarta Cathedral (Indonesian: Gereja Katedral Jakarta) is a Roman Catholic Cathedral in Jakarta, Indonesia, which is also the seat of the Roman Catholic Archbishop of Jakarta, currently Archbishop Ignatius Suharyo Hardjoatmodjo.

Its official name is Gereja Santa Maria Pelindung Diangkat Ke Surga.

This current cathedral was consecrated in 1901 and built in the neo-gothic style, a common architectural style to build churches at that time.

The Jakarta Cathedral is located in Central Jakarta near Merdeka Square and Merdeka Palace, it stands right in the front of Istiqlal Mosque.
